I haven't gone too far yet but I'm enjoying it a whole lot! Playing on Heroic, I found the beginning floor to be more challenging than past entries'. 

The intro was really slow. The setup is that the flying city of Maginia, led by the princess Persephone Maginias (she's the one handing out Missions), set out to explore the yet unexplored island of Lemuria with a bunch of explorers. There is a World Tree there, and the promise of some sort of relinquished treasure is fueling hopes. You happen to be on board but aren't officially sanctionned just yet. Upon landing, there is no labyrinth to explore, as the land is unknown. It is implied that acknowledged guilds are searching the island for points of interest. 

Gunther Mueller (that name...) is the guild master and helps the creation of your original party. But he says you can't be admitted to the princess headquarter until you have proven your worth. He thus encourages you to go to the bar and take on Quests. From the Japanese, I couldn't really understand if he meant to acknowledge you as full-fledged adventurers upon the completion of a few Quests but, as one would expect, everything works out in the end. 

The barkeep is a japanese caricature of a middle-aged queer, so you you know... Anyway, his name is something like Klaus or Kvas (can't remember). Now, and this is where the game starts to open up, the two quests he gives you finally let you leave the city! But there is no labyrinth to explore! Instead, from the cool-looking world map, you choose to go to points of interest where text-based events occur. One of them ended up in my first fight, the other resolved itself through dialog choices. Those events completed, upon turning them in at the bar, you learn of the lost Brigitte-chan, who disappeared north of town. You thus set out to investigate her whereabouts at an inconpicuous point of interest...

There, you save Brigitte-chan from flesh-eating koalas or something and, after agreeing to look for her friend ライカ who is like a younger sister to her, you investigate the surrounding. What you find is what you were looking for: a title screen on which is written "First Labyrinth BF1". The setting is that of ruins overgrown by jungle-like vegetation (reminiscient of EO1 Stratum 2 to me). I found the area noticeably darker than past entries' first stratum. The recurring theme of the area is smell. Everything stinks in there! Some enemies are skunks, and many EOV-type events are centered around bad odors!

Upon finding ライカ for Brigitte-chan, you realize that ライカ is a dog and its romanized name of Laika now makes a lot more sense. You then decide to go back to town with Brigitte-chan and report that you found ruins to the princess. Long story short, you are praised by Persephone who offers you to prove your worth by mapping the new Labyrinth you just discovered. You thus set out for the ruins map in hand to complete what has been the first Mission of everey EO thus far: map some stuff. But this time there's a twist! You can't complete this Mission without killing what ends up being the game's first boss: a really intimidating plant monster that actually managed to wipe my party (and I was really glad to be so challenged!). I killed it on my second try and then stopped playing. 

As you can see I haven't progressed much, but as I'm trying to learn new Kanjis along the way, it can sometime be arduous to keep a brisk pace. 

Enough story rambling, unto gameplay stuff:

My initial party is Nightseeker, Imperial, Shogun, War Magus and Ninja. I'm heavy on ailments but I might be lacking in the defense boosting department, nothing that can't be remedied by subclassing later on I hope. I'm enjoying the setup thus far but it is somewhat fragile. I hadn't realized the armor limitation of the shogun prior to adding it to my party but I'll try working around it as I enjoy dual-wielding classes. 

Speaking of subclass, it's been a while since I played EO4 but I'm excited to try out combos once the system is unlocked! My dodge tanking ninja dream might yet be possible! 

The Force system of EOU2 is back and, although there's no Fafnir, it's still a lot of fun. The reason I didn't win my first encounter with the plant monster was because I didn't properly force break. I thus have reasons to believe its usage will be determinant during FOE/Boss fights, which is exciting! 

If you haven't noticed yet, I really like the game up to now! It's holding my attention a lot more than EOV (which I also played in Japanese, though I was a real beginner back then; I am now intermediate I'd say so my understanding might be a factor). I can't wait to dive back in!

So I left the first labyrinth after only 1 floor and now I'm in Etrian Odyssey 4. Litterally. The first floor of this here new dungeon is the exact same as the first from EO4, and I'm fighting baboons and grasshoppers and stuff. Even the bear foes are at the same place as they used to be. I knew strata would come back but I didn't know it'd be exactly the same maps. The battle music too is from EO4.

I suppose it'll diverge as I go deeper down the floors, but I was still surprised. Before I entered, some adventurers from Tharsis (the EO4 city) were saying "I know this place". My guess is that the island of Lemuria, for some lore reasons that make no real sense, will aggregate all other instances of the World Trees. They mentionned 7 World Trees in the prologue, and there's been 7 other mainline entries in the series, so I'd wager there'll be references to all the past titles. By the way, EOX is technically the 10th entry if we include the mystery dungeon spinoffs so the X has a deeper meaning to that effect. On the JP Website (I think that's where I saw that), there's also reference to 10 years, 10 titles... It truly is supposed to be the end of the 3DS and DS era, huh?

Reached the 5th dungeon so far and I'm having a pretty good time. This game does a good job at shaking up the returning dungeons to make if feel familiar but also freshen up the experience. The last floor of the second dungeon has some of my favourite events in the series.

 My party is Imperial/Highlander/Hero/Arcanist/Zodiac. Having an Imperial at the beginning of the game is really weird. Drives cost a ton in this game so they can't spam them for rando fights but it's fun to manage the TP cost during boss fights. Zodiacs have really good synergy with Imperials since their force break makes the TP cost for turn 0. 

I had a fairly rough time with bosses since I had all of one buff and no debuffs before hitting level 20. If there's one thing I'd want to change in this game I'd get rid of EOIV's level gating skill trees. It makes some classes really limited until they hit level 20/40. My Arcanist only set up circles and casted dismissal heal before I got veteran skills. 

Also any fans of EOIII music will be in for a treat.
